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19481309 20435 94
5228800611 247871
5228800611 247871
833832 576 98770921
All about undefined
Interested in learning more?
5228800611 247871
833832 576 98770921
See more
57 40 923772
08 35116 080114969
See more
711 986 8591946
02646 238 955 02333
See more